Unique kitchen centerpieces for the kitchen
Retro fridges and freezers can be an ideal addition to any kitchen. They can add a retro flair to contemporary or modern designs, as well as a bold quirk to country-style designs. They can add a splash of color to traditional or industrial spaces. No matter what style of kitchen you prefer there's bound to have a fridge or freezer that will meet your needs.

Versatility
Retro refrigerators come with many of the same features of modern refrigerators despite their vintage design. You'll find an ENERGY STAR(r) certification as well as no-frost technology, LED interior lighting, and door storage bins as well as adjustable glass shelves and a more crisp drawer. Some include an adjustable wine rack and shelves in the freezer compartment to provide maximum flexibility.
